The news of the mainland actor Wang Xinyang’s death at the age of only 55 has sparked heated discussions, with the topic trending on social media. His son expressed shock and surprise at the news of his father’s death and, as he did not want an autopsy to be conducted, the true cause of Wang Xinyang’s death remains a mystery.

On September 5th around 8 p.m., the grassroots actor Wang Xinyang passed away unexpectedly in a rental house in Xi’an. Wang Xinyang’s son and several friends from the entertainment industry confirmed the news.

On the evening of the 8th, Wang Xinyang’s son, Mr. Wang, stated that his father did not have any major illnesses before his death, and he was generally in good health, although he had high blood pressure, diabetes, and occasionally enjoyed drinking alcohol. At the time of the incident, he was filming a short drama in Xi’an. The crew tried calling him but received no response. When they went to check on him, they found that he had passed away and immediately reported it to the police. The police ruled out homicide and suicide.

“The circumstances surrounding my father’s death shocked and surprised me. The cause of death would only be known after an autopsy, but considering he has already passed away, conducting one would be meaningless. His body has already been cremated, and we will bring his ashes back to our hometown for burial.”

Mr. Wang mentioned that his father was from Cangzhou, Hebei, and after a business failure, he went to Hengdian to work as an extra in film and television productions, where he has been working as an actor for 9 years.

In recent years, Wang Xinyang appeared in TV dramas such as “The Awakening Age,” “Mountain and River Clear Streams,” “Peach Blossoms Still Smile in the Spring Wind,” and “Black and White Forest.”

A notice of Wang Xinyang’s passing was posted on his personal social media account stating: “I regret to inform everyone that the original user of this WeChat account, Wang Xinyang, has passed away. The account is now managed by his son.”

A Weibo member and entertainment blogger known as “Fatty Luffy” mentioned that Wang Xinyang was in high spirits while filming and still had scenes left to shoot.
